For an unusual, but stunning mix of color, try the All the Blues Butterfly Bush. A mix of Buddleja davidii Buzz™ 'Buzz Midnight', 'Buzz Sky Blue', and 'Buzz Lavender' in one container, this combination will produce an array of flower spikes from spring onwards. All the Blues Butterfly Bush is bound to draw attention and grows to around 3 feet tall.
Like other Butterfly bushes, All the Blues Butterfly Bush will attract all manner of pollinators but especially bees and butterflies. It is easy to grow and care for and needs little ongoing care once established. It is cold hardy and grows in USDA zones 5 to 10. Being deer resistant, this deciduous shrub is a go-to for rural locations. It is ideal for growing as a single specimen in a container or as a drift in a mixed border.
All the Blues Butterfly Bush Care
The All the Blues Butterfly Bush performs best planted in full sun, but can also tolerate partial shade. It prefers a moist, yet free-draining soil and can cope with most soil types. Water regularly until established, after which it can tolerate some dry conditions. Although not a heavy feeder, you can apply a slow-release, general-purpose fertilizer in early spring to give it a boost.
Deadheading faded flowers will help encourage new blooms to form over the growing season. For a neat appearance, you can prune lightly in early spring before new growth appears. Make angled cuts back to new buds.
All the Blues Butterfly Bush Spacing
In the right conditions, the All the Blues Butterfly Bush will reach 2 to 3 feet tall and wide. Plant on its own in a large container, or space plants 2 to 3 feet apart in a landscape.
